Commencing The Journey

  • Selecting the Appropriate Raspberry Pi Model
    Initiating your arcade apparatus project mandates the judicious selection of a suitable Raspberry Pi model. Choosing the latest version guarantees optimal performance and smooth integration with state-of-the-art gaming applications. Take the Raspberry Pi 4, for instance, which offers enhanced processing power and a variety of features.

Vital Constituents

Before plunging into the assemblage procedure, procure the indispensable components:
  • Raspberry Pi
  • MicroSD Card (featuring the Raspbian OS)
  • Arcade Cabinet
  • Joysticks and Buttons
  • Power Supply
  • Monitor/Display

Initializing Raspberry Pi

  • Inaugurating The Raspbian OS Installation
    Embark on the journey by formatting your MicroSD card and executing the installation of the Raspbian operating system. Adhere diligently to the official Raspberry Pi documentation for a seamless initiation, guaranteeing the operational status of your system.

Configuring RetroPie

RetroPie is the crucial software for turning your Raspberry Pi into a powerful gaming machine. You may adjust its settings to fit your favorite arcade games and personalize the UI to suit your preferences.
